The Substance Abuse and Mental Health Services Administration, "SAMHSA" for short, is the government department in charge of health efforts to advance the mental health of the nation. One of its responsibilities is the oversight of opioid rehab programs, which are programs which offer medication-assisted treatment (MAT) to individuals who are in the midst of opioid dependency and addiction. Drug administered are drugs like methadone, buprenorphine and other drugs which stop withdrawal and curb cravings for opioid dependent clients. SAMSHA certified opioid treatment centers in Cedar Brook are programs which are officially permitted to dispense the drugs used in MAT as long as they remain certified and continue to meet certain requirements. A requirement that MAT clients must also get auxiliary benefits in addition to medication such as counseling or behavioral therapy.

An opioid treatment center can receive basic certification while they endeavor to get their full accreditation, however, are required to get their full accreditation in a year. Opioid rehab programs accredited by SAMSHA need to get licensed also by their own state. Likewise, they must register with the Drug Enforcement Administration through a local DEA office. Once an opioid treatment facility is certified, it must be re-certified each year or every 3 years contingent upon the kind of accreditation that was given.
